The table represents the linear function f(x), and the equation represents the linear function g(x). Compare the y-intercepts an

d slopes of the linear functions f(x) and g(x) and choose the answer that best describes them. x f(x) 0 1 2 9 4 17 g(x) = 3x + 1

Answer:

The y-intercepts of both functions are the same and the function f(x) has a greater slope than the function g(x)

Step-by-step explanation:

we know that

The formula to calculate the slope between two points is equal to

m=\frac{y2-y1}{x2-x1}

step 1

Determine the slope of the function f(x)

take two points from the table

(0,1) and (2,9)

substitute in the formula

m=\frac{9-1}{2-0}

m=\frac{8}{2}

m_1=4

Remember that the y-intercept is the value of y when the value of x is equal to zero

In this problem the point (0,1) is the y-intercept

so

b_1=1

step 2

Determine the slope of the function g(x)

we have

g(x)=3x+1

This is the equation of the line in slope intercept form

y=mx+b

where

m is the slope

b is the y-intercept

so

In this problem

m_2=3

b_2=1

step 3

Compare the y-intercepts and slopes

b_1=b_2\\m_1 > m_2

The y-intercepts of both functions are the same and the function f(x) has a greater slope than the function g(x)

In the x-y plane, what is the y- intercept of the graph of the equation y=6 (x-1/2) (x+3)
Ivenika [448]

The y-intercept on the x-y plane is (0, -9).

<h3 /><h3>How to get the y-intercept?</h3>

To get the y-intercept we just need to evaluate in x = 0.

Here we have:

y = 6*(x - 1/2)*(x + 3)

Evaluating the given equation in x = 0 we get:

y = 6*(0 - 1/2)*(0 + 3) = -9

Then the y-intercept on the x-y plane is (0, -9).
